Porter County has a predicted average indoor radon screening level between 2 and 4 pCi/L (pico curies per liter) - Moderate Potential
Air Quality Index (AQI) level in 2010 was 37.8. This is about average.
Lead (Pb) [µ/m3] level in 2008 was 0.0231. This is significantly better than average. Closest monitor was 10.9 miles away from the city center.
Carbon Monoxide (CO) [ppm] level in 2002 was 0.642. This is about average. Closest monitor was 11.1 miles away from the city center.
Sulfur Dioxide (SO2) [ppb] level in 2010 was 1.79. This is better than average. Closest monitor was 0.6 miles away from the city center.
Nitrogen Dioxide (NO2) [ppb] level in 2002 was 21.9. This is significantly worse than average. Closest monitor was 9.3 miles away from the city center.
Particulate Matter (PM10) [µ/m3] level in 2010 was 19.3. This is about average. Closest monitor was 0.7 miles away from the city center.
Particulate Matter (PM2.5) [µ/m3] level in 2010 was 11.6. This is worse than average. Closest monitor was 2.3 miles away from the city center.

Burns Harbor compared to Indiana state average:
- Median household income above state average.
- Unemployed percentage below state average.
- Black race population percentage significantly below state average.
- Hispanic race population percentage significantly above state average.
- Median age above state average.
- Renting percentage significantly below state average.
- Number of college students below state average.
- Percentage of population with a bachelor's degree or higher below state average.
